Delete or recreate website created with RVsitebuilder 7

Delete old content and recreate site on the same domain name
If you'd like to delete your existing website, and recreate it, just simply create a new website selecting the same domain name.
Here's a guide that will help you get started: https://user.rvsitebuilder.com/docs/7.3/en/website-design
Please note, this will completely overwrite the current content.
Permanently delete all*
If you want to delete content permanently from your domain name, you can do it by following guide. It will delete all folders and files related to RVsitebuilder.
*This will permanently delete all and cannot restore.
1. Delete database
1.1 You can check database name for the domain name by this guide.
1.2 Delete database in cPanel > MySQL® Databases, at Current Databases list look for database you want to delete.
1.3 Select Actions "Delete" > Delete Database
2. Delete folder "rvsitebuildercms/{DOMAIN}"
2.1 Go to cPanel -> File Manager > rvsitebuildercms folder > delete folder {DOMAIN}
